If you’re an angler with an iPhone, you’ll want to take advantage of the latest advancements in technology for fishing, all for under $4.

FishMate is the first iPhone application designed specifically to help anglers load the live well, packing an incredible array of data and information into one easy-to-use interface.

“When I was a kid growing up on Smith Lake in Alabama, I had to read the paper, listen to the radio and study an almanac to figure out the best time to go fishing,” laughs FishMate creator Sammy Lee. “I never had one source of information that would provide everything I needed until now.”

Drawing on more than 30 years of experience as a professional tournament angler, a marine industry rep and a professional broadcaster, Sammy has put together what he terms “a killer app for fishermen everywhere.”

Lee reported after a trial period with bass pros who use iPhones and are typically on the leading edge of technology, they wholeheartedly endorsed the concept for their tour fishing.

“And the younger collegiate anglers, at universities who have started tournament fishing, are quickly buying the app for a competitive edge,” he added. “It’s a constant companion.”

There are features and benefits on the numerous screens. Fire up FishMate, and immediately you get the best “Fishin’ Times” for the day at your location – worldwide -- with times for moonrise and moonset, sunrise and sunset, plus the major and minor feeding periods.

A touch of the screen also takes you to current weather conditions, including temperature, humidity, barometric pressure, wind speed and direction. There’s also an extended forecast prepared for your current location or anywhere else you plan to wet a hook.

That might be plenty for some fishermen, but FishMate gives you more. Another touch of the screen loads you up with tournament news, fishing tips and tackle information from the most informed sources in the industry, including the BASS Reporter’s Notebook and FLW Outdoors.

After you’ve used the information from your FishMate to set up the perfect fishing pattern, you can touch the screen again while you’re waiting for a big strike and listen to podcasts of “Tight Lines with Sammy Lee”, America’s longest-running syndicated radio fishing program. Another fun feature, the “Big’uns” page, allows lucky fishermen to post details of their catches, with photos, for other anglers to enjoy, utilizing social networking media like FaceBook.

“I’d buy it even if I hadn’t designed it,” says Sammy. “FishMate really does give you all the information you need to plan a fishing trip anywhere in the world.”

FishMate, priced at just a one time charge of $3.99, can be purchased online at Apple’s iTunes Store in the Apps section. For more go to: tightlinesradio.com/FishMateDetails.html

A version for other smart phones will be ready for download next month. FishMate was designed by Sammy Lee Enterprises, Inc. in conjunction with OpenMetrics, Inc.
